When I first got brawl me and my brother effectively banned MK and Snake as we knew they were too good. We wanted to get a feel for all the characters while not getting the wrong impressions of how good/bad they are based on some matchups vs the two obviously top characters. To this list we also added Olimar. We weren't very good at the time so his cstick spam was unbeatable My first tier list in April had Olimar in his own 'broken as f**k tier' and claims of olimar being top tier were laughable. As time goes on I stand by my early claim of Olimar being top tier and over the past few months ive observed many things which I believe indicate this may indeed be true. Not now, but sometime in the future I still believe he will be top tier.
Its not all just my biased claims though and bad experiences vs Olimar which leads me to think this. Allow me to divulge.
In the early MU threads everyone has the advantage on olimar. Hes so easy to gimp, dies at 50% every stock. This rapidly changed once people actually played against olimar. Whistle armor, uair and proper DI had many Olimar players rarely getting gimped at all and the best players proved it. In a very short space of time his major weakness was proven not to be so detrimental after all. It still affects him greatly but people accepted getting him offstage is a seriously hard task. Some seriously damaging combos are also found with him being able to combo most heavies up to 40%+ and even lightweights, if he reads an AD correctly anyone can take huge damage from his extremely easy to land combos from his grab. Olimar is looking dangerous.
Then came the period of 'perfect camping'. With people mastering pivot grabs and spacing, could it be possible to defeat every enemy without ever being hit? Full-blown camping strategies begin to bring his matchups vs Metaknight and Falco close to even. Although not feasible entirely, his camping strategies become no joke and most characters are now no longer figuring out how to get him offstage, getting past his pivot grab is the new aim.
And then the period of what I call realisation. Characters who assumed to have a large advantage vs Olimar actually play vs good Olimar players can come to the realisation that getting past his camping is a lot more than putting theory into practice. Many of his matchups as discussed by other boards begin to state that "Olimar is much harder than we thought"
I read through almost all character matchup threads on a very regular basis and a common theme is developing. Olimar is harder than what is currently listed. From the bottom of the tiers with jiggly, ganon etc claiming a nigh unwinnable MU vs him to the top of top tier with Snake and DDD admitting a sizeable disadvantage to Olimar and MK/diddy/wario being very close to even. I dont think Ive read a single character MU thread without at least one mention of Olimar being a candidate for hardest matchup. This observation is becoming more and more common as time goes on, I believe it will continue as people get more experience vs a wider variety of players and realise this for themselves.
So in summary, my observations;
Olimar shoots up tier list rapidly after proving what hes capable of.
Boasts advantages of near even matchups vs almost all of top tier.
Is a candidate for the hardest MU for an extremely wide variety of characters. From DDD, Snake, Diddy, Lucario, Toon Link, Sonic, Sheik, Ike... the list goes on.
IMO, a character with those sort of traits is top tier. Snake, Wario, Diddy etc do not even come close to boasting the amount of hardest matchups that olimar does. In some ways it looks to me like he is the melee sheik. He may not have the potential to win major tournaments, but he invalidates the majority of the cast to a much larger degree than any other top tier character except MK. In this respect he is similar to Marth, except he boast an advantage agasint D3 and Snake with a disadvantage to MK which is worth a lot in the current Brawl metagame, hence Marths current placement. I still believe Olimar will be top tier by the time brawl is finished (MK Snake/IC's Olimar for top 4) and if these trends continue, it may be sooner than we think :/
